Quick note before Thursday's sync: the Brindlewood API is chewing through Postgres connections again. Reminder that every service should go through the shared pooler, not direct connections — we cap at 20 per service for a reason. If you're spinning up a new worker, check your pool settings twice. Idle timeout is 30s; don't override it without asking. Setup steps, sizing guidance, and the current allocation table are on the internal page here.

wiki page, tahaf-tajog: https://jira.ordindyn.corp/pipeline

Subject: DR drill report — Cindervane firmware channel

Hello — as promised, here is the summary for your review. During the drill we rerouted the Cindervane device-firmware update channel through the Hallowmere backup distribution tier. Signature verification, staged rollout gating, and rollback triggers all behaved as documented. One note: restoring the primary channel requires operator confirmation, which accepts only the recovery passphrase recorded below.

strongbox words: zordor-quenax

## Further reading

The Pairline matching service runs on a generational collector, and long pauses under allocation spikes have caused missed match windows twice. Before touching heap settings, read the pause-time analysis from the Corbeck incident and the allocation-profiling notes. Key points: young-gen sizing dominates, large ephemeral candidate sets are the main offender, and tuning without a reproduction harness has historically made things worse. The full tuning history and harness instructions are maintained here.

operations page: https://jenkins.zemvarcloud.local/job/merge_requests/repo/build/73930b4b30f0a8ed

**Ticket: AGT-57 — HarrowLink Telemetry Gateway Buffering**

For review: the HarrowLink gateway, which relays telemetry from field equipment to the Fallowmere ingestion service, loses readings during cellular dropouts. This change adds a disk-backed buffer with bounded retention and replay ordering guarantees. Please examine the flush logic and failure paths closely. Merge is blocked pending sign-off from the approver named below.

account owner for bawip-tahag: Raleth Quenok